Detailed analysis of the Mercedes-Benz C 180 BlueEFFICIENCY Estate Aut. · 156 CV (2011-2012)
General description
The 2011 Mercedes-Benz C 180 BlueEFFICIENCY Estate Aut. is a family sedan that combines classic Mercedes elegance with modern functionality. This model, with its 156 HP gasoline engine and 7-speed automatic transmission, presents itself as a balanced option for those seeking comfort and efficiency in a premium vehicle.
Driving experience
Behind the wheel of this C-Class, the feeling is one of poise and smoothness. The hydraulic steering, although not speed-sensitive, offers precise feedback that inspires confidence. The suspension, with McPherson struts at the front and a multi-link setup at the rear, masterfully filters out road irregularities, providing a serene and comfortable ride. The 0 to 100 km/h acceleration in 9.1 seconds is adequate for most situations, and the top speed of 216 km/h ensures good performance on the highway. It's a car that invites you to enjoy every journey, whether in the city or on long trips.

Technology and features
This model incorporates BlueEFFICIENCY technology, which aims to optimize fuel consumption and reduce emissions. The 1.8-liter gasoline engine, with direct injection, turbo, and intercooler, offers a good combination of power and efficiency. The 7-speed automatic transmission manages power smoothly and effectively. Additionally, it features a Stop/Start system that contributes to efficiency in urban environments. Although it is not a car with the latest connectivity innovations of today, its mechanical technology was well-resolved for its time.
Competition
In its segment, the Mercedes-Benz C 180 BlueEFFICIENCY Estate Aut. competes with models such as the BMW 3 Series Touring, the Audi A4 Avant, and the Volvo V60. All of them offer a similar combination of luxury, performance, and versatility, but the C-Class stands out for its focus on comfort and elegance, maintaining its own identity within the competitive premium family sedan market.
